If you’ve ever dabbled in affordable Android TV boxes, digital signage, or embedded DVR systems, you have likely encountered the HiSilicon Hi3798 series. For years, this System-on-Chip (SoC) has been the beating heart of countless devices, from high-end Huawei media centers to generic white-label boxes floating around online marketplaces.
